Narration

So we’re primarily going to use the IVC to assess fluid or hydration status from a flat collapsible IVC that could benefit from hydration versus a dilated non collapsible IVC that may be present in fluid overload or CHF. On occasion we can see other pathologies such as this IVC where we can see a hyperechoic area waving around there that is actually a clot or thrombus.
